What Causes This Problem
- Fires in homes or businesses produce smoke that penetrates surfaces.
- Incomplete combustion releases toxic soot and chemical residues indoors.
- Poor ventilation traps smoke contaminants inside structures after fires.
- Items like drywall soak up odors and residues from smoke exposure.
- Residual ash and soot particles cause ongoing health risks and damage.

Can Smoke Damage Sanitation Prevent Long-Term Health Issues?
Yes, thorough sanitation removes toxic residues and particulates that could cause respiratory or skin problems, helping protect your health over time after a fire.
How Soon Can Smoke Damage Sanitation Begin After A Fire?
We recommend starting sanitation as soon as it is safe, ideally within 24 to 48 hours, to prevent smoke residues from setting and causing further damage.
